I have a K Swapped EG thats been on the road for about 4 months. I did have a few teething problems at first like the classic idle issues etc but most of these problems were solved by reading threads on here.
Recently though the car has developed a bit of hesitation at low throttle between ~2-3k rpm. I have done the usual fixes with new plugs and coilpacks but to no avail.
I have also read that this is also quite common issue with dodgy TPS's, the one on the car was a brand new Honda OEM fitted when the car first got put on the road as the old one was damage. It was all calibrated when fitted so that no throttle produced 0% signal and at full throttle it produces 100/101% so I'm pretty confident thats good. I then did some data logging to see if the signal from the TPS was noisy, which seemed fine but i did notice that the ignition timing seems to go weird when the hesitation occurs.
Details
- K swapped EG with UKDM K20A2 out an EP3
- K-Pro 2 Serial 0309
- Kmanager 4.2.5
- ECU 37820-PRA-E11
- Running the stock calibration with tweaks just to remove EVAP, Immobilizer, secondary 02 etc.
